WebFabrics are made from yarns and yarns are made from fibres. Based on the origination, we can classify fibres into two classes- namely plant fibres and animal fibre. WebJan 18, 2024 · 4) Burrs separation: The small fluffy fibres called burrs are separated from the hairs and again washed and dried. 5) Dyeing: the natural hair of sheep is white, brown, black. The raw fibres are dyed in different colours. 6) Spinning: The raw fibres are then straightened, combed and rolled into yarn.
